Hi all, just got 370 z 2014 from auction house in US.

In front me are happy days of repairing the car. Already have an issue with starting the car. The key can open and close doors but when clicking on the Start button on the dashboard there is just that orange icon car with key inside blipping.

You can not see millage or nothing on the dashboard just that icon blipping.

 

Changed battery of the car, battery of the keys, no help...maybe someone can guide me in the right direction.

 

I found that this switch is not connected. It is near Start button. Someone recognize where it goes?

According to the internet, 2012 - 2014 US cars still had the steering lock fitted, so it could be this issue, symptoms match

 

I would genuinely test for that first

Then I'd check the steering lock fuse and relay in the power distribution module (the box by the battery)

Then I'd check the wiring diagram and pull some trim off and trace where that plug should be

If its in the steering column area it could either be from the combination switch, or from the media. 

 

If you don't have one, download the service manual and check either BCM or AV sections, there will be a wiring diagram towards the back of the section and also a page showing the harness plugs with wire colours.  Find a match.

 

The steering lock will be in the PCS section.

 

Its a balls ache but that's the only way I can think of to identify that plug.

The start issue may or may not be related to the plug.  The way start works is....

 

You press the start button and BCM checks brake pedal switch, key fob authentication, & clutch/gear position

BCM sends an 'ok to start' to the IPDM

IPDM energises the start control relay and the start relay

 

So I'd work through that list starting with checking the brake pedal switch.
